  • As a freelance audio engineer for over a decade, using a compressor or limiter in software will only prevent peaking/distortion if you're adjusting the volume in software as well. What most people have issues with is distortion that occurs in the audio interface itself, usually by setting the volume too high.

    My recommendation for OBS users would be to set their audio interface volume quite low, so that even when you yell, it doesn't peak or distort. Then, in OBS, set a Noise Gate filter to block out any ambient background noise your microphone is picking up, followed by an Upward Compressor filter to bring the volume back up to listening volume. Specifically, it'll only raise the volume of quieter parts, while keeping the volume of louder parts unchanged (such as when you yell etc.)

    If you want to get fancy, you can even link Compressor filters together so that, for example, your game or BGM audio will automatically lower in volume when you talk, and return to normal volume when you stop speaking. That way you don't need to worry about your voice being drowned out by loud game audio.

    Many moons ago I went to school for audio engineering so maybe this'll be helpful:

    One handy thing to know about audio on YouTube, if you're setting a brickwall limiter for your audio so you don't peak (hardware or software), try to set it so that you don't go above -1db. YouTube & most streaming platforms (even Spotify) like to try to normalize audio a lil bit & if it sees you're encroaching on 0db it'll sometimes compensate by turning down the entire audio channel on the viewer's side.

    Mari's 100% right on compressors being your best friend - pairing it with a gate is also very handy too if you have a lot of background noise you'd like to not bleed through constantly as well. Just make sure you figure out the db level of your noise floor so that you're not cutting out your own voice with it as well lol.

    Audio engineering major here! I'm graduating with my degree in one week! I haven't tried streaming apps yet myself, so I don't have suggestions for settings there, but you could look into limiters if you're yelling a lot. Compressors actually reduce the dynamic range of your mix (how loud the loud things are and how soft the soft things are), but it depends on what settings you use. For example, you can set up a ducking compressor for things like reducing the loudness of background music whenever you talk. Focusrite is a good decently priced audio interface, and if you want something high-end, you could go for an interface by Universal Audio. I can vouch for the UA Apollo Twin X Duo being really nice.
